About the Role

Sunreef Yachts, world leader in luxury catamaran design and manufacturing, is looking for a Senior Designer – Deck Equipment and INOX to join our engineering team in Gdańsk, Poland .

In this role, you’ll play a vital part in the development and integration of custom-designed deck equipment and structural INOX components across our yacht range. You will work closely with classification societies, suppliers, subcontractors, and internal design teams to develop high-quality, certifiable solutions aligned with our innovation and luxury standards. The position is both technical and collaborative, offering an opportunity to work on complex, custom-built yachts from concept to production.

Key Responsibilities

  • Development of structural solutions and selection of deck equipment
  • Creation and supervision of technical documentation in 3D and 2D (classification, production, purchasing) in accordance with Classification Society regulations and contractual requirements
  • Technical support and mentoring of project team members
  • Analysis of production non-conformities and optimization of design processes with regard to productivity, cost efficiency, and compliance with design assumptions
  • Cross-discipline coordination and technical discussions with Classification Society representatives, suppliers, and subcontractors, including participation in project and interdepartmental meetings
  • Review and quality control of technical documentation prepared by internal and external designers
  • Reporting of progress and design errors

Requirements

  • Experience in designing steel structures and outfitting elements for ships or yachts, including prototype components
  • Knowledge of material strength, kinematic systems design, and metal processing technologies (stainless steel, carbon steel, aluminum)
  • Familiarity with 2D documentation for classification requirements for ships or yachts – ability to create, review, and supervise technical and production drawings
  • Knowledge of welding processes, including welding technologies and quality requirements relevant to the design and certification of steel structures
  • Proficiency in SolidWorks and AutoCAD (or similar software)
  • Strong communication skills and fluency in English (minimum B2 / C1), enabling daily technical collaboration with clients and external partners
  • Ability to perform FEA (Finite Element Analysis) calculations – considered an asset
